qssvc.exe is part of QS Client Service and developed by QS according to the qssvc.exe version information.
qssvc.exe's description is "QS Client Service"
qssvc.exe is digitally signed by Quick Surf.
qssvc.exe is usually located in the 'C:\Program Files (x86)\QuickSurf_1.10.0.20\Service\' folder.
Some of the anti-virus scanners at VirusTotal detected qssvc.exe.

12 of the 56 anti-virus programs at VirusTotal detected the qssvc.exe file. That's a 21% detection rate.
| Scanner | Detection Name |
|---|---|
| Avast | Win32:Vitruvian-B [PUP] |
| AVware | InfoAtoms (fs) |
| Baidu-International | Adware.Win32.Vitruvian.F |
| DrWeb | Adware.Plugin.1137 |
| ESET-NOD32 | a variant of Win32/Adware.Vitruvian.F |
| Fortinet | Adware/Vitruvian |
| Kaspersky | not-a-virus:AdWare.Win32.Vitruvian.o |
| Malwarebytes | PUP.Optional.QuickSurf.A |
| NANO-Antivirus | Riskware.Win32.Vitruvian.duihcy |
| Panda | Generic Suspicious |
| Tencent | Win32.Adware.Vitruvian.Wnvs |
| VIPRE | InfoAtoms (fs) |
